Abstract

The purpose of this note is to give a natural approach to the extensions of the Banach contraction principle in metric spaces endowed with a partial order, a directed graph or a binary relation in terms of extended quasi-metric. This novel approach is new and may open the door to other new fixed point theorems. The case of multivalued mappings is also discussed and an analogue result to Nadler's fixed point theorem in extended quasi-metric spaces is given.
